The Parthenon, an iconic temple perched atop Athens' Acropolis, stands as a timeless symbol of ancient Greek civilization. Built in the 5th century BCE, this architectural marvel was dedicated to Athena, the city's patron goddess. Its stunning Doric columns and intricate sculptures showcase the pinnacle of classical artistry and engineering. Despite centuries of wear, including damage from wars and looting, the Parthenon remains a breathtaking testament to human creativity. Today, it draws millions of visitors who marvel at its grandeur and historical significance. A visit here offers a glimpse into the glory of ancient Athens, making it a must-see for history and architecture enthusiasts alike.
